Come experience the machines of yesteryear with the Sussex Antique Power Association, Inc. 54th Annual
Threshing Bee
and Engine Show!

August 25-26, 2012

Admission $5.00 for ages 12 & up 11 & younger free with adult!
9:00am to 5:00pm
All children must be accompanied by an adult!

Featuring: International Harvester Tractors, Engines, and Implements.

Our Show will also feature samplings of the following!
Steam Traction Engines
Saw Mill, Threshing Machines
Blacksmith demonstrations (with many handcrafted items for sale.)
Water Pumping Engines
Shingle Mill, Feed Grinding
Operating Steam Museum
Corn Shellers
Antique Trucks, Cars, Motorcycles, and Tractors
Model Airplanes flying by the Circle Masters Flying Club
A wide variety of 'Hit and Miss' and antique gasoline engines
Old Washing Machines and other household items
Antique Boat Motors, and much more...
